Motion Control Engineer (45%): A key role in developing and optimizing motion control systems for various applications, requiring expertise in electrical, mechanical, and control engineering principles. 2. Automation Specialist (25%): An expert in designing, implementing, and maintaining automated systems to improve efficiency, reduce costs, and enhance safety in industrial and manufacturing environments. 3. Robotics Engineer (15%): A professional responsible for designing, developing, and testing robotic systems used in manufacturing, healthcare, and other industries, focusing on the integration of sensors, actuators, and control systems. 4. Mechatronics Engineer (10%): A versatile engineer combining mechanical, electrical, and software engineering to create smart machines and systems, often found in automation, robotics, and manufacturing. 5. Control Systems Engineer (5%): A specialist responsible for designing, analyzing, and optimizing control systems for various applications, leveraging mathematical models, feedback, and advanced algorithms to ensure stability and performance.
